Detailed Solution

Electric current corresponding to the revolution of electron is i=ev2πr. Magnetic field due to circular current at the centre is B  =  μ04π . 2πir  =  μ04π . evr2 ⇒  r= μ04π .evB  ⇒  r ∝  vB
